Technical features and application fields of mullite concrete

May 13,2025

I. Product features

1. Excellent high temperature performance. Mullite concrete has a fire resistance limit of 1600-1700℃ and can be used as a working lining in direct contact with flames. It is especially suitable for thermal equipment in high temperature environments. It has a stable crystalline phase structure and excellent heat resistance. It can maintain its structural integrity even under rapid cooling and rapid heating conditions, effectively extending the life of the furnace lining.

2. Lightweight structure design The gradient ratio technology of the porous mullite filler reduces the apparent density of the material by 40%-60% compared with traditional refractory materials, greatly reducing the load on the equipment. The lightweight characteristics not only reduce the load-bearing capacity requirements of the steel structure, but also completely solve the hidden danger of the traditional hanging brick structure being prone to breakage, and also improve the safety of equipment operation.

3. High-performance, energy-saving insulation material adopts a closed-cell microporous structure, with a thermal conductivity of less than 0.45W/(m·K) at room temperature, and an insulation performance of more than 30% even under high temperature conditions. The unique heat insulation effect effectively reduces the outer wall temperature of the furnace body, achieving a comprehensive energy saving of 15% to 20%, and meeting the energy-saving transformation needs of industrial furnaces.

4. Convenient structural characteristics It has the characteristics of rapid solidification and early strength, and compared with traditional materials, the maintenance cycle is shortened by 50%, and the kiln firing time is shortened by 30% to 40%. It adopts integral casting technology, which can quickly repair structures with complex special shapes, greatly shortening the construction cycle, and is especially suitable for emergency repair projects and projects with strict construction schedules.

2. Application fields

1. Petrochemical industry • Cracking unit: light oil cracking furnace, ethane cracking furnace working lining • Refinery unit: atmospheric and vacuum furnace section, sulfur recovery unit reactor • Auxiliary system: flue lining, waste heat boiler sealing layer

2. Energy and electrical engineering • Power plant boiler: cyclone separator wear layer, return material insulation lining • Waste heat power generation: sintering machine waste heat boiler, coking dry cooling device

3. New material field • Polysilicon production: reduction furnace lining, exhaust gas cleaning system • Lithium battery material: rotary kiln transition zone, cooling section insulation layer

4. General industrial stage • Special equipment: single layer lining of double shell cylinder, compensation fireproof layer • Auxiliary parts: furnace door sealing frame, inspection hole insulation layer • Special structure: tortoiseshell mesh reinforced composite lining, special shape prefabricated block
